AI comment — why bullish
The digital asset landscape is currently exhibiting robust growth, with Bitcoin's ascent towards anticipated price points being a prominent feature. This upward trajectory is significantly influenced by consistent capital allocation into spot Bitcoin Exchange-Traded Funds, indicating a strengthening positive outlook for cryptocurrencies. This trend may reflect an evolving investor base, increasingly viewing Bitcoin as a more established asset class. The current market dynamics are consistent with projections of ongoing institutional engagement, a narrative that has been developing over time. Such performance can foster increased investor conviction, potentially leading to a greater willingness to allocate capital towards riskier assets as the market processes the effects of enhanced accessibility and demand, which could, in turn, stimulate further investment across the wider digital asset sector.
